Balvenie Doublewood 12

This is a mild scotch.  No smoke.  Not a lot of sherry, (although that is the second cask used in this double cask).  It is readibly available in Canada for a modest price.   It is not at all harsh, but no deep flavours of any kind.  So it is kind of a whisky for Scotch whiskey drinkers who don't really like the taste of Scotch!  As a review, this one was pretty easy, as there is nothing wrong with it.  Just not a lot RIGHT about it either.  It was quite pleasant in a mild sort of way, and I would probably buy Balvenie doublewoood scotch Whisky again.  After I have tried a lot of others first!

GlenFarclas 12

This is an easy review: I really like this Scotch.  Glenfarclas is not harsh.  There is no smoke for those smoke loving Scotch drinkers, but it really does a fine job as a bit of a Sherry bomb.  The sherry taste is strong and satisfying. This is good Whisky.  I move this one to close to the head of the pack in terms of a good, relatively inexpensive, single malt whisky that will have wide appeal.
